Administrator
2025-07-02 82f0d56e8e25f56bf109db6e5d3dcec7a507ad4e
日志调整/bug修复
2个文件已修改
15 ■■■■■ 已修改文件
code_attribute/code_volumn_manager.py 2 ●●● 补丁 | 查看 | 原始文档 | blame | 历史
l2/l2_data_manager_new.py 13 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史
code_attribute/code_volumn_manager.py
@@ -161,7 +161,7 @@
        _volumn = global_util.today_volumn.get(code)
        if _volumn is None:
            _volumn = RedisUtils.get(self.__redis_manager.getRedis(), "volumn_today-{}".format(code))
        return _volumn
        return int(_volumn)
    # 获取今日量
    def get_today_volumn_cache(self, code):
l2/l2_data_manager_new.py
@@ -852,11 +852,14 @@
                cancel_type = trade_constant.CANCEL_TYPE_J
        if cancel_data and not DCancelBigNumComputer().has_auto_cancel_rules(code):
            l2_log.debug(code, "触发撤单,撤单位置:{} ,撤单原因:{}", cancel_data["index"], cancel_msg)
            # 撤单
            cls.cancel_buy(code, cancel_msg, cancel_index=cancel_data["index"], cancel_type=cancel_type)
            # 撤单成功,继续计算下单
            cls.__process_not_order(code, cancel_data["index"] + 1, end_index, capture_time, is_first_code)
            try:
                # 撤单
                cls.cancel_buy(code, cancel_msg, cancel_index=cancel_data["index"], cancel_type=cancel_type)
                # 撤单成功,继续计算下单
                cls.__process_not_order(code, cancel_data["index"] + 1, end_index, capture_time, is_first_code)
            finally:
                l2_log.debug(code, "触发撤单,撤单位置:{} ,撤单原因:{}, 下单模式:{}", cancel_data["index"], cancel_msg,
                         f"{order_begin_pos.mode}")
        else:
            pass